William Henry Hill papers
Collection
Identifier: 2398
Abstract
Papers of William Henry Hill, who was a New York State and United States congressman, National Convention delegate, member of the New York State Republican Party executive committee, chairman of the Broome County Republicans, publisher of the Binghamton Sun, and Central New York State Parks Commissioner.
Dates:
1878-1964,-1918-1964 (bulk)
